Output 75f65616b35aa05c26ab26f5c52af208943122b2fa7f11a1a36ccfc286d065ba:1

value
37688821
script pubkey
OP_0 OP_PUSHBYTES_20 256ed5884803df8e85107a2eee8cc0afc4a8d04d
address
bc1qy4hdtzzgq00capgs0ghwarxq4lz235zd5ctxzz
transaction
75f65616b35aa05c26ab26f5c52af208943122b2fa7f11a1a36ccfc286d065ba
confirmations
156998
spent
true